New Posts
 
Is there a way that New Posts will only show posts we haven't seen the latest on yet? This happens OK the firs time, but if I come back later to the site without signing off it gives me the same posts again!

When you've finished reading all the threads you are interested in, go to "Quick Links" and select "Mark Forums Read".

My best advice is to click on the 'New Posts' when you first sign on....look through all the threads/posts you want to. Then just keep clicking 'New Posts' whenever you want to look for new stuff to read. The threads in which you've recently read all the posts will show up as non-bold and threads with new posts since you've viewed them will be BOLD in the list. Newest material is always at the top. Hope this helps.

And the 'View First Unread' is a great feature to use, but if you've already looked at a thread once, it still takes you to the first unread since you signed in.
